Extra High Voltage Cables Market Demand, Innovations & Future Outlook
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on LInkedIn


The Extra High Voltage (EHV) cables market is witnessing significant growth due to rising electricity demand and the need for efficient long-distance power transmission. These cables play a critical role in modern grid infrastructure, enabling reliable energy flow with minimal losses. Valued at approximately $41.46 billion in 2024, the market is projected to reach $83.84 billion by 2034, driven by infrastructure expansion and renewable energy integration.

What are the Key Drivers of the Extra High Voltage Cables Market?

The market is primarily driven by the increasing demand for reliable and efficient power transmission systems. Rapid urbanization and industrialization are pushing utilities to upgrade grid infrastructure, especially in emerging economies.

Another major driver is the growing integration of renewable energy sources such as wind and solar. These energy sources are often located far from consumption centers, necessitating advanced EHV cables for long-distance transmission.

Additionally, government investments in grid modernization and electrification projects, including smart grids and industrial electrification, are significantly boosting demand.

What are the Key Trends Shaping the Market?

One of the most notable trends is the expansion of High Voltage Direct Current (HVDC) technology, which enables efficient bulk power transmission over long distances with reduced energy losses.

There is also a growing shift toward underground and submarine cable installations, driven by urban land constraints and offshore renewable energy projects.

Technological advancements in cable materials, such as cross-linked polyethylene (XLPE), are improving performance, durability, and safety. Furthermore, increasing investments in research and development and patent activity are fostering innovation across the value chain.

What Challenges and Opportunities Exist in the Market?

The market faces several challenges, including high manufacturing and installation costs, as well as the technical complexity of designing cables capable of handling ultra-high voltages.

A shortage of skilled professionals for installation and maintenance also poses risks to project timelines and costs.

However, these challenges open up opportunities for innovation and collaboration. Advancements in materials, improved installation techniques, and partnerships between manufacturers and utilities are helping overcome these barriers. Moreover, the increasing demand for grid resilience and energy efficiency is creating new growth avenues for EHV cable solutions.

Trending FAQs for Extra High Voltage Cables Market

What are Extra High Voltage (EHV) cables?

Extra High Voltage cables are power transmission cables designed to carry electricity at voltage levels typically above 220 kV for long-distance and high-capacity transmission.

Why are EHV cables important in power transmission?

They enable efficient long-distance electricity transfer with minimal energy loss and help maintain grid stability.

What is driving the growth of the EHV cables market?

Rising electricity demand, renewable energy integration, and investments in grid infrastructure are the key growth drivers.

How do renewable energy projects influence EHV cable demand?

They require long-distance transmission to connect remote generation sites to power grids, increasing the need for EHV cables.
